Types of Personality Disorders
The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ders (DSM-5) categorizes personality disorders into 3 clusters:
Cluster A: Odd or Eccentric Disorders
Paranoid Personality DisorderSchizoid Personality DisorderSchizotypal Personality Disorder
Cluster B: Dramatic, Emotional, or Erratic Disorders
Antisocial Personality DisorderBorderline Personality DisorderHistrionic Personality DisorderNarcissistic Personality Disorder
Cluster C: Anxious or Fearful Disorders
Avoidant Personality DisorderReliant Personality DisorderObsessive-Compulsive Personality Disorder
Understanding the specific kind of personality disorder is crucial for targeting proper treatment interventions.
The Mental Health Assessment Process
mental health assessment in primary care health assessments for personality disorders generally include several essential parts. These assessments are essential in formulating a diagnosis and establishing a treatment plan customized to the individual's needs. The primary actions consist of:
clinical mental health assessment Interview: An extensive interview assists collect important details concerning the individual's history, signs, behaviors, and how these impact their daily life.
Standardized Assessments: Utilizing standardized tools to determine personality qualities and identify patterns. Typically utilized assessments include:
Personality Assessment Inventory (PAI)Millon Clinical Multiaxial Inventory (MCMI)Minnesota Multiphasic Personality Inventory (MMPI)
Behavioral Observations: Observing the person in various settings and situations can supply important insights into their behaviors and interactions with others.
Security Information: Gathering information from relative, pals, or previous therapists can also support the assessment process.
Table: Common Assessment Tools for Personality DisordersAssessment ToolDescriptionPersonality Assessment Inventory (PAI)A self-report questionnaire that examines various psychological conditions and personality characteristics.Millon Clinical Multiaxial Inventory (MCMI)Focuses on personality disorders and their relationship to clinical syndromes.Minnesota Multiphasic Personality Inventory (MMPI)One of the most widely utilized psychometric tests, assessing characteristic and psychopathology through self-report.Importance of Comprehensive Assessment

Throughout a mental health assessment, a person can anticipate a substantial interview with a mental health professional, who will ask about individual history, existing issues, habits, and sensations. Standardized questionnaires and tests may likewise be administered.
How long does a mental health assessment take?
The period of a mental health assessment can differ substantially. Initial assessments can take anywhere from 1 to 3 hours, while follow-up assessments might be much shorter.
Will I need to undergo several assessments?
Yes, in some cases, multiple assessments may be required to ensure an accurate diagnosis, track treatment progress, and improve intervention techniques.
Can personality disorders improve with treatment?
Yes, specific outcomes can differ, but many individuals with personality disorders can show substantial improvement in symptoms and function through suitable therapy and support.
What are the barriers to getting a mental health assessment?
Barriers can consist of stigma surrounding mental health, a lack of access to mental health services, and financial restraints. Getting rid of these barriers frequently includes increased education and availability efforts.
